28.5.2 Two Points To Remember About Trigger Ports

1. Trigger events only happen on data that is going coming from inside the ZyWALL and going to the

outside.

2. If an application needs a continuous data stream, that port (range) will be tied up so that another

computer on the LAN can’t trigger it.

Only one LAN computer can use a trigger port (range) at a time.
